    Abstract: While transmitting any one transmission signal of a plurality of transmission signals, a transmitting-receiving unit in a radar device acquires, as a reception signal for target detection, a reception signal of a frequency band different from a frequency band of the transmission signal, and blocks a reception signal of the same frequency band as the frequency band of the transmission signal.

    Abstract: Disclosed is a radar signal processing device including a shift unit to shift either one of an ascending sequence signal in which the frequency of a pulse wave rises discretely with time and a descending sequence signal in which the frequency of a pulse wave falls discretely with time.

    Abstract: A radar device includes a suppression band variable filter that, while a circulator outputs any one transmission signal out of a plurality of transmission signals to an antenna, and the antenna transmits the transmission signal, suppresses a signal of the same frequency channel as a frequency channel of the transmission signal, and passes a signal of a frequency channel different from the frequency channel of the transmission signal.

    Abstract: In a radar device, a wide band filter unit suppresses unnecessary components contained in a reception signal subjected to frequency conversion by a frequency conversion unit. The wide band filter unit has frequency characteristics for performing filtering so that isolation between transmitting and receiving becomes a desired level or lower. Although the wide band filter unit has an increased noise power compared to a matched filter, the wide band filter performs the filtering so as not to round a pulse waveform.
